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,body,html,p,blockquote,fieldset,input{
    margin:0;
    padding:0;
}
ul{ list-style:dotted;}
fieldset{ border:0;}
a img{ border:0;}
.clear{clear:both;}
body {background: #47443c;}
a{  color: #bd7821;
    text-decoration: none;
}
h1 {
    font-size:30px;
    font-weight:bold;
    color:#666666;
    line-height:1.5;
    padding: 5px 0px 5px 0px;
}
h2 {
    font-size:20px;
    color:#666666;
    line-height:1.5;
    padding: 5px 0px 5px 0px;
}
.td {
   border-width: 0px 0px 1px 0px;
   border-style:solid;
   border-color:#555;	
}
#bann_img{
	z-index:2;
    width: 432px;
    height:27px;
    padding: 0px 0px 0px 0px; 
    float:left;
    text-align:left;
    position:relative;  
    margin-top:0px;
    margin-bottom:0px;
    background:#010101; 
}
#nav{
	z-index:1;
    position: relative;
    float:right;
    background:#010101; 
    width: 508px;
    height: 26px;
    padding: 0px; 
    margin-top:1px; 
    margin-bottom:0px;
    text-align:right;   
}
#man_shell{
	background: #010101;
	width: 940px;
	min-width:940px;
	height:610px;
	margin:auto;
	margin-top:70px;
	padding-bottom:auto;
	text-align:center;   
    position:relative;
	float:center;
	border-width:25px 25px 32px 25px;
    border-style:solid;
    border-radius:0px; 
    border-color:#222;
}
#man_cont{
	width:940px;
    min-height:570px;
    padding: 0px 0px 0px 0px;  
    border-radius:0px; 
    margin-top:-7px; 
    text-align:center; 
    background: #010101;
}
#shw_cont {   
	width:940px;
	height:573px;
	float:center;
	font-size:12px;
	font-family:arial;
	letter-spacing:1px;
	color:#666666;
	margin-top:0px; 
	margin-left:0px;
	padding: 0px 0px 0px 0px;
	background:#010101;
	text-align:center;
	vertical-align:middle;
} 
#instruct {
	position:relative;
	float:center;
	width:420px;
	margin-top:0px;
	padding:20px 5px 20px 5px;
	background:#302523;
	font-size:8pt;
	letter-spacing:1px;
	font-family: arial;
	text-align:center;
	color:#999999;
	border-radius:7px;
}
#ms {
	width:130px;
	height:15px;
	position:relative;
	text-align:left;
	background:#222222;
	
	margin-left:0px;
	margin-right:0px;
	margin-top:6px;
	margin-bottom:0px;
	border-radius:0px;
	vertical-align:middle;
	padding:0px 0px 0px 0px;
	float:left;
}
#btm_div {	
	font-family:verdana,georgia,arial;
    font-size: 9px;
    letter-spacing:1px;
    color: #C1BDBC;
    text-transform: none;
    background: #222;
    border-width:0px 0px 0px 0px;
    border-style:solid;
    border-color:#1A1919;
    padding: 0px 0px 0px 0px;
    width: 940px;
    height:22px;
    margin-top:0px;
    vertical-align: top;
    position:absolute;   
}
#footer {
	font-family:Helvetica,georgia,verdana,arial;
    font-size: 10px;
    letter-spacing:1px;
    color: #76706D;
    text-transform: uppercase;
    background: #222;
    border-width:0px 0px 0px 0px;
    border-style:solid;
    border-color:#444444;
    padding: 0px 0px 0px 0px;
    margin-top:7px;
    text-shadow:#000000 0px -1px 1px; border-radius:2px;
    position:relative;
	text-align:right;
	float:right;
}
#profile {
        width: 940px;
        height:576px;
        border:0px solid #888888;
        padding-left:0px;
        padding-right:0px;
        padding-top:0px;
        padding-bottom:0px;
        text-align:right; 
        background:#010101 url("0b0g_p0ro.jpg");
        top: 0;
        left: 0;
        background-repeat:no-repeat;
        margin-bottom: 0px;
        margin-left: 0px;
        margin-right: 0;
        margin-top: -3px;
        margin-bottom:0px;
        }
.profile_txt {
	    width: 350px;
        height:490px;
	    font-family:verdana,arial;
        font-size:9pt;
        color:#777777;
		letter-spacing:1px;
      	word-spacing:-1px;
      	line-height:140%;
        text-align:justify;
        padding: 15px 20px 20px 15px;
        background:;
        float:right;
        margin-right:29px;
        -moz-border-radius:5px;
	    -webkit-border-radius:5px;
	    border-radius:5px;	   
}         
#proof {
        width: 938px;
        height:576px;
        border:0px solid #888888;
        padding-left:1px;
        padding-right:0px;
        padding-top:0px;
        padding-bottom:0px;
        text-align:right;
        vertical-align:middle;
        background:#010101 url("0b0g_p0gal.jpg"); 
        background-repeat:no-repeat;
        margin-bottom: 0px;
        margin-left: 0px;
        margin-right: auto;
        margin-top: -3px;
        margin-bottom:0px;
        -moz-border-radius:0px;
	    -webkit-border-radius:0px;
	    border-radius:0px;
}
#proof_txt {
	width: 350px;
        height:200px;
	    font-family:verdana,arial;
        font-size:9pt;
        color:#999999;
        letter-spacing:1px;
        word-spacing:-1px;
        text-align:center;
        padding: 10px 20px 0px 50px;
        background:#222;
        margin-left:250px;
        margin-right:auto;
        margin-top:165px;
        margin-bottom:0px;
        -moz-border-radius:5px;
	    -webkit-border-radius:5px;
	    border-radius:5px;
	    position:absolute;
	    float:center;
	    border-width:1px 1px 1px 1px;
		border-style:solid;
		border-color:#333;
	    opacity:0.9;filter:alpha(opacity=90);
}	   
#prf_er {
	display:none;
	position:relative;
	height:48px;
	width:408px;
	font-size:8pt;
	line-height:15px;
	font-family:verdana;
	color:#FE9A2E;
	background:#111;
	text-align:left;
	margin-left:-31px;
	margin-top:3px;
	-moz-border-radius:5px;
	-webkit-border-radius:5px;
	border-radius:5px;
	padding:2px 2px 6px 10px;
	border-width:0px 1px 1px 1px;
	border-style:solid;
	border-color:#222;
}
#svc {
        width: 938px;
        height:576px;
        border:0px solid #888888;
        padding-left:1px;
        padding-right:0px;
        padding-top:0px;
        padding-bottom:0px;
        text-align:center; 
        background:#010101 url("bg_ser_v.jpg");
        top: 0;
        left: 0;
        background-repeat:no-repeat;
        margin-bottom: 0px;
        margin-left: 0px;
        margin-right: 0;
        margin-top: -3px;
        margin-bottom:0px;      
        }        
#svc_detail{
		width:405px;
		height:515px;
		background:#111; 
		font-family:verdana;
		font-size:8pt;
		letter-spacing:1px;
		text-transform:none;
		padding:0px 10px 20px 0px; 
		border-radius:0px;
		margin-left:-40px;
		margin-top:5px;
		border-width:0px 0px 0px 0px;
		border-style:solid;
		border-color:#333333;
		-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=80)";
		opacity:0.9;
		-moz-box-shadow:0.7px 0.7px 1px #111;
		-webkit-box-shadow:0.7px 0.7px 1px #111;
		box-shadow:0.7px 0.7px 1px #111;	 
}
#contact {
        width: 940px;
        height:576px;
        border:0px solid #888888;
        padding-left:0px;
        padding-right:0px;
        padding-top:0px;
        padding-bottom:0px;
        font-family:verdana,arial;
        font-size:9pt;
        color:#FE9A2E;   
		letter-spacing:1px;
      	word-spacing:1px;
        text-align:right;
        background:#010101 url("0b0g_co0txt.jpg");
        background-repeat:no-repeat;
        margin-left: 0px;
        margin-right: 0;
        margin-top: -3px;
        margin-bottom:0px;
        float:left;
        -moz-border-radius:0px;
	    -webkit-border-radius:0px;
	    border-radius:0px;
        }
#contact_frm {
        width: 370px;
        height:535px;
        border:0px solid #888888;
        padding-left:20px;
        padding-right:20px;
        padding-top:0px;
        padding-bottom:0px;
        margin-bottom: 0px;
        margin-left: 0px;
        margin-right: 20px;
        margin-top: 18px;
        margin-bottom:0px;
        float:right;
        text-align:left;
        background:#111;
        border-width:1px 1px 1px 1px;
 		border-color:#333;
 		border-style:solid;
 		border-radius:7px;
        opacity:0.7;filter:alpha(opacity=70); 
        }	                
input[type="submit"]{
        border:1px solid #444444;
        background: #302523;
        color:#A4A4A4;
        font-family: verdana,book antiqua,sans-serif;
        font-size:7pt;
        font-weight: none;
        letter-spacing:2px;
        text-transform:uppercase;
        border-radius:5px;
        padding:4px 12px 4px 12px;
        }
input[type="submit"]:hover{
        border:1px solid #444444;
        background: #302523;
        color:#fff;
        border-radius:5px;
        padding:4px 12px 4px 12px;
     }  
input[type="button"]{
        border:1px solid #444444;
        background: #302523;
        color:#A4A4A4;
        font-family: arial,book antiqua,sans-serif;
        font-size:6pt;
        font-weight: none;
        letter-spacing:2px;
        text-transform:uppercase;
        border-radius:3px;
        padding:3px 3px 1px 3px;
        margin-top:-10px;
        }        
form,fieldset {
        width: 370px;
        height:400px;
        border:0px solid #888888;
        float:right;
        text-align:left;        
        }
.frm_dom {               
        border:0px solid #444444;
        height:18px;
        color:#fff;
        font-family: verdana,book antiqua,sans-serif;
        font-size:9pt;
        font-weight: none;
        letter-spacing:0px;
        word-spacing:-1px;
        border-radius:5px;
        background-color:#2B2423;
        border-width:1px 1px 1px 1px;
        border-color:#333;
        border-style:solid;
        display:inline;
        float:left;
        opacity:0.8;filter:alpha(opacity=80);
        }  
#input-961031549180100296 { background-color:#312A2A; opacity:0.8;filter:alpha(opacity=35);}   
textarea {
      overflow-y: auto;
      overflow-x: hidden;       
      width:367px; height: 80px;
      resize: none;   
}
.weebly-form-input,.wsite-form-input{
	background: #FFFFFF url(form_input_bg.gif) repeat-x scroll center top;
	border-color: #7C7C7C #C3C3C3 #DDDDDD;
	border-style: solid;
	border-width: 1px;
	padding: 4px !important;
}
.formlist{
	min-height: 100px;
	margin: 0px !important;
	padding: 0px !important;
}
.form-input-error{
	border-color: #FE9A2E;
}
.form-not-required{
	display:none;
}
.form-required{
	display: inline;
	color: #FE9A2E;
}
.frm_label {
      font-size:8pt;
      font-family: arial,book antiqua,sans-serif;
      color:#777777;
      letter-spacing:1px;
      word-spacing:-1px;
      text-transform:uppercase;
      border:0px;
      margin:5px 0px 5px 0px;
      
  }
#event_tpy {  
 height:80px;
 display:none;
 position:absolute;
 background:#111;
 color:#fff;
 font-size:10px;
 margin-top:1px;
 margin-left:230px;
 padding:3px 3px 3px 1px; 
 -moz-border-radius:7px;
 -webkit-border-radius:7px;
 border-radius:7px;
 opacity:0.7;filter:alpha(opacity=70);
 border-width:2px 2px 2px 2px;
 border-color:#191919;
 border-style:solid;
 z-index:1; 
} 
#menubar {           
	display: block;
	vertical-align:top;
	width:940px;
	height:22px;
	font-family:verdana,arial;
	font-size:10px;
	text-transform:none;
	letter-spacing:3px;
	color:#666600;
	background:#222222;
	margin-top:-2px;
	padding:5px 0px 0px 0px;
	opacity:0.4;filter:alpha(opacity=40);
	opacity:0.9;-moz-box-shadow:0.4px 0.4px 0px #222222;
	-webkit-box-shadow:0.4px 0.4px 0px #222222;
	box-shadow:0.4px 0.4px 0px #222222;
}  
.weebly_form_sublabel{
    display: block;
    padding-bottom: 5px !important;
    font-size: 11px;
    margin-left:0px
}
.wsite-form-field{
	clear: both;
}
ul#css3menu1,ul#css3menu1 ul{
	width:auto; height:0 auto;
	margin:0;list-style:none;
	background-color:#000;
	background-repeat:repeat;
	border-width:0px;
	border-style:solid;
	border-color:#111111;
	border-radius:0px;}
ul#css3menu1 ul{      	                          
	display:none;
	position:absolute;
	left:0;
	top:100%;
	padding:0px 7px 7px;
	background-color:#222222;
	background-image:none;
	border-width:1px;
	border-style:solid;
	border-color:#111111;
	} 	
ul#css3menu1 li:hover>*{
	display:block;}
ul#css3menu1 li:hover{
	position:relative;}
ul#css3menu1 ul ul{
	position:absolute;
	left:100%;
	top:0;
	opacity:90; }
ul#css3menu1{
	padding:0px 1px 1px 0;
	display:block;
	font-size:0;
	float:left;}
ul#css3menu1 li{
	display:block;
	white-space:nowrap;
	font-size:0;
	float:left;}
ul#css3menu1>li,ul#css3menu1 li{
	margin:0 0 0 1px;}
ul#css3menu1 ul>li{
	margin:0px 0 0;}
ul#css3menu1 a:active, ul#css3menu1 a:focus{
	outline-style:none;}
ul#css3menu1 a,ul#css3menu1 a.pressed{           
	letter-spacing:1px;
	display:block;
	vertical-align:middle;
	text-align:center;
	text-decoration:none;
	font: 10px Arial;
	color:#cccccc;
	cursor:pointer;}
ul#css3menu1 ul li{
	float:none;margin:9px 0 0;}
ul#css3menu1 ul a{                              
	text-align:left;
	padding:1px 0 0 0;
	background-color:#222222;
	background-image:none;
	border-width:0px 0 0 0;
	border-style:solid;
	border-color:#262626;
	font:9px Arial;
	letter-spacing:2px;
	color:#888888;
	text-transform:uppercase;
	}
ul#css3menu1 li:hover>a{                        
	background-color:#aaaa7f;
	border-style:none;
	font: 10px Arial;
	color:#ffffff;
	text-decoration:none;
	background-image:url("img_0me0nu0btn.png");
	background-position:0 100px;}
ul#css3menu1 img{
	border:none;
	vertical-align:middle;
	margin-right:10px;}
ul#css3menu1 img.over{
	display:none;}
ul#css3menu1 li:hover > a img.def{
	display:none;}
ul#css3menu1 li:hover > a img.over{
	display:inline;}
ul#css3menu1 li a.pressed img.over{
	display:inline;}
ul#css3menu1 li a.pressed img.def{
	display:none;}
ul#css3menu1 span{
	display:block;
	overflow:visible;
	background-position:right center;
	background-repeat:no-repeat;
	padding-right:0px;}
ul#css3menu1 ul span{
	background-image:url("arrowsub.gif");
	padding-right:20px;}
ul#css3menu1 a{                                 
	padding:8px;
	background-color:#333;
	background-image:url("img_0me0nu0btn.png");
	background-repeat:repeat;
	background-position:0 190px;
	border-width:0px;
	border-style:none;
	border-color:;
	color:#888;
	text-decoration:none; 
	text-transform:none;}
ul#css3menu1 li:hover>a{                       
	background-color:#222;
	background-image:url("img_0me0nu0btn.png"); 
	background-position:0 190px;
	border-style:none;
	color:#888;
	text-decoration:none;}
ul#css3menu1 li>a.pressed{  
	background-color:#222;
	background-image:url("img_0me0nu0btn.png");
	background-position:0 195px;
	border-style:none;
	color:#AB4047;
	text-decoration:none;}
ul#css3menu1 ul li:hover>a,ul#css3menu1 ul li>a.pressed{ 
	background-color:#222222;
	background-image:none;
	border-style:solid;
	border-color:#262626;
	font:9px Arial;
	letter-spacing:2px;
	color:#F2F2F2;
	text-decoration:none; 
	text-transform:uppercase;
	}
ul#css3menu1 li.topmenu>a{  
	height:10px;
	line-height:10px;
	text-shadow:#000000 0px -1px 1px; border-radius:0px;
	}
ul#css3menu1 li.topmenu:hover>a,ul#css3menu1 li.topmenu>a.pressed{
	line-height:15px;
	}
ul#css3menu1 ._>li>a{
	padding:0;}
ul#css3menu1 li.subfirst>a{                      
	border-width:10;
	border-style:none;
	text-shadow:#000000 0px -1px 1px;
	padding-top:6px;margin-top:-5px;}
ul#css3menu1 li.subfirst:hover>a,ul#css3menu1 li.subfirst>a.pressed{
	border-style:none;margin-top:-5px;}

